マーティン・ファウラーとは

※人物名ですので、IT用語という訳ではないのですが、APPSWINGBYが得意とするリファクタリングの分野において、最も著名な技術者ですので、敢えてここでも紹介しています。

マーティン・ファウラー(Martin Fowler)とは、ソフトウェア開発分野、特にオブジェクト指向分析設計、UMLデザインパターン、アジャイルソフトウェア開発、リファクタリングなどの分野で著名なソフトウェア技術者、著者、講演者です。

人物像

  • イギリス出身のソフトウェアエンジニアであり、現在はアメリカを拠点に活動しています。
  • Thoughtworksのチーフサイエンティストを務めています。
  • 著書や講演を通じて、ソフトウェア開発に関する様々な概念やプラクティスを提唱し、世界中の開発者に影響を与えています。
  • アジャイルソフトウェア開発宣言の起草者の一人でもあります。

主な貢献

代表的な著書

関連用語

アジャイル開発 | 今更聞けないIT用語集
ソフトウエアアーキテクチャ | 今更聞けないIT用語集
リファクタリング

お問い合わせ

システム開発・アプリ開発に関するご相談がございましたら、APPSWINGBYまでお気軽にご連絡ください。

APPSWINGBYの

ソリューション

APPSWINGBYのセキュリティサービスについて、詳しくは以下のメニューからお進みください。

システム開発

既存事業のDXによる新規開発、既存業務システムの引継ぎ・機能追加、表計算ソフトによる管理からの卒業等々、様々なWebシステムの開発を行っています。

iOS/Androidアプリ開発

既存事業のDXによるアプリの新規開発から既存アプリの改修・機能追加まで様々なアプリ開発における様々な課題・問題を解決しています。


リファクタリング

他のベンダーが開発したウェブサービスやアプリの不具合改修やソースコードの最適化、また、クラウド移行によってランニングコストが大幅にあがってしまったシステムのリアーキテクチャなどの行っています。